Job description

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including product management, sales, finance, customer success, and senior leadership to capture key data and identify data-driven insights.
  • Analyze, and interpret large and complex data sets related to business performance, account growth, and product usage, etc.
  • Create and develop detailed financial models and analysis to support various strategic initiatives including market analysis, customer segmentation, product usage, etc.
  • Create and deliver high-impact reports and interactive dashboards that intuitively communicate or visualize key insights to senior leadership.
  • Create and deliver executive sales dashboards for monthly review by senior leadership.
  • Assess and process map methodologies to identify and implement data governance, innovative workflows, or efficiencies to enhance our data mining efforts.

Requirements

We are seeking a talented, highly motivated individual to join our Business Insights team at our New York headquarters. The ideal candidate will have a love of data and proficiency in researching, customizing, exacting, evaluating, identifying trends, managing, and translating data into actionable business insights., * A bachelor’s degree in finance, data science, or economics.

  • 3-5 years’ experience in analyzing markets, product, generating financial statements, data analysis, or dashboard creation.
  • Possess strong critical thinking and data analysis skills.
  • Proven ability to present complex data and insight to senior leadership.
  • Proficiency in predictive modeling, presentation and report generation.
  • Strong demonstratable experience in Excel, PowerPoint, SageX3, or Salesforce.
  • Experience with programming languages commonly used in data analysis (i.e. SQL, Python)
  • Experience creating complex queries for data extraction and reporting.
  • Experience with Data modeling applications such as Tableau or PowerBI.
